KUWAIT, Aug 10 (KUNA) -- Bahraini Prime Minister Khalifa Bin Salman
Al-Khalifa arrived here Wednesday in a one-day official visit to the country.
The Bahraini guest and his accompanying delegation were received at Kuwait
International Airport by HH the Prime Minister Sheikh Nasser Al-Mohammad
Al-Ahmad Al-Sabah, First Deputy Premier and Minister of Defense Sheikh Jaber
Al-Mubarak Al-Hamad Al-Sabah.
The guests were also received by Deputy Premier and Interior Minister Ahmad
Al-Humoud A-Sabah, Deputy Premier and Foreign Minister Sheikh Dr. Mohammad
Sabah Al-Salem Al-Sabah, Deputy Premier, Minister of Justice and Minister of
Awqaf Dr. Mohammad Al-Afasi, Deputy Minister of Amiri Diwan Affairs Sheikh Ali
Al-Jarrah Al-Sabah, senior officials at HH the Prime Minister's Diwan and
ambassadors of the two countries.
In a statement upon arrival in the country, Prince Khalifa Bin Salman said
he was pleased to be a guest of "our brother Sheikh Sabah Al-Ahmad Al-Jaber
Al-Sabah, the Amir of the sisterly State of Kuwait."
The prime minister said his visit was part of continuous contacts between
the two countries "aimed at consolidating our distinctive and brotherly
relations."
Al-Khaifa said he was conveying greetings of the Bahraini people to the
people of Kuwait, affirming the brotherly and solid ties bounding them.
"Kuwait and Bahrain have been throughout history a single country and a single
people united by common features," he added.
He affirmed that his visit was of special significance in the shadow of
"rapid events happening in the region," noting that he would exchange views
with the Kuwaiti leaders on various issues and means of promoting the
bilateral ties. (end)
